Boscastle Scramble 2026
The Boscastle Scramble returns on the 27th June 2026! – 26.2 Miles along the North Cornwall Coast path from Rock to Boscastle! This event features 3 checkpoints along the way, with significant ascents and descents, and a 9-hour cut-off time!
New for 2026, the Boscastle Soft Boiled Relay offers a two-person team entry. Runner number one starts at Boscastle, with a changeover with your team mate at CP2 in Port Isaac. Teams start at the same time as the Scramble with the same CP cut-offs and will have a separate category with medals featuring a different ribbon.
Navigate your way along some of the most notorious coast path along the North Cornish Coast, making your way through Polzeath, Port Isaac & Tintagel along the way! Live GPS tracking, medals for all, awards for top finishers and free race photography!
This is a self-navigation exercise along the SWCP with manned checkpoints providing fluid and sustenance along the route. The Scramble also serves as Stage 3 of The Saints & Smugglers 100 Mile Challenge.
Optional extras include mini bus return transport and a race tee.
